Remarks

This is better college in terms of faculty and education. But if you want to have extra curricular activity as part of education.Then this is one of the worst college to be.

Entrance Preview

I had to attend Andhra Pradesh Engineering Common Entrance Test and Scored a rank. I wanted to join a college which is close to city limits so opted for this college.

Course Curriculum Overview

3.5

Curriculum is defined by Osmania University, Hyderabad. So College has no role to play in designing curriculum. The curriculum matches international standards.

Internships Opportunities

No internship is provided by the College. I earned a internship which dint pay any stipend as such. I applied through public advertisement for internship.

Placement Experience

1.5

The placement are not so great. With a great difficulty we convinced our management to allow software companies to at least all the branches ( not only for computer science engineering). I was placed in Satyam Computers ( Hyderabad), with a package of 2.4 Lks per annum. Later i rejected the offer and opted for higher education.

College Events

1.5

The college did not encourage any such events. So we organised only one technical seminar in 2006 that too with great difficulty. That program was only attended by our college guys.

Fee Structure And Facilities

I was offered a Government Quota seat. The fee was 22.5K per year. It was very comfortable for me and main reason to choose this college. You have to pay fees for each year at the beginning of the semester.

Fees and Financial Aid

I dont think loan is required for your education. And if you opt for loan, there wont be any support from college administration. But i have few friends who opted for loan facility and there wont be any major issue to grant loan.

Campus Life

3.5

No extra curricular activity, no events, no parties, no workshops, no cultiral societies and very few girls and majorly. no alcohol ! So if you want all that stuff, kindly opt for another college.

Alumni/Alumna

The alumni network is pretty good. But you hardly find it. Because everyone opted for higher studies and are settled abroad. If you want to meet them its better you go abroad.

Exam Structure

Exam structure is very comfortable. Exams are conducted for every semester and internals are conducted for every 45 days. This is part of continuous assessment. But it was great fun preparing for exams.

Faculty

3.5

I would rate faculty 3/ 5. Few professors are extraordinary and few are as dumb as students. Only few Professors hold PhD degree so the quality of faculty is great for only those courses.
